Impact of Sunlight Intensity
Occasionally, the strength of sunlight can dramatically impact the efficiency of solar panels. When the sunlight is strong and straight, your photovoltaic panels create even more electrical energy. However, during cloudy days or when the sun is at a reduced angle, the panels obtain much less sunlight, minimizing their efficiency. To make best use of the power result of your solar panels, it's crucial to install them in locations with sufficient sunshine direct exposure throughout the day. Think about variables like shielding from nearby trees or buildings that could obstruct sunshine and reduce the panels' efficiency.
To maximize the effectiveness of your solar panels, consistently clean them to get rid of any kind of dirt, dirt, or debris that may be blocking sunlight absorption. Furthermore, ensure that your panels are angled correctly to get the most straight sunlight feasible.
Impact of Temperature Level Modifications
When temperature level adjustments happen, they can have a substantial effect on the effectiveness of solar panels. Solar panels function best in cooler temperatures, making them more efficient on light days contrasted to exceptionally warm ones. As the temperature raises, solar panels can experience a decrease in efficiency due to a phenomenon called the temperature coefficient. This result causes a decrease in voltage result, eventually impacting the total power manufacturing of the panels.
Alternatively, when temperatures go down as well low, solar panels can likewise be influenced. Exceptionally cold temperatures can cause a decline in conductivity within the panels, making them less effective in creating electricity. This is why it's vital to take into consideration the temperature problems when installing photovoltaic panels to maximize their performance.
